In a significant step towards revitalizing handball in Kogi State, the Kogi State Handball Association has appointed Coach Omada Ene-Ojo as its new Technical Director.
The announcement was made by the Chairman of the Association, Mr. Jibril Ojih Saidu (FNIQS), during the official inauguration ceremony held on Wednesday, July 9, 2025, at the Confluence Stadium Complex, Lokoja.
A former professional handball player turned coach, Omada Ene-Ojo brings years of experience and passion for the game to his new role. His appointment is seen as a strategic move to harness and develop local talent and enhance the technical capacity of the sport in the state.
Mr. Saidu, who also serves as the North-Central Representative on the board of the Handball Federation of Nigeria, praised Coach Omada for his dedication, grassroots impact, and unwavering commitment to mentoring young athletes in Kogi.
“This appointment is a recognition of Coach Omada Ene-Ojo’s tireless efforts in promoting handball at the grassroots. We believe his experience and leadership will help drive the transformation we seek in Kogi handball,” Saidu said.
He emphasized that the position comes with significant responsibility, urging the new Technical Director to channel his expertise into elevating the sport’s profile and nurturing the abundant untapped talent across the state.
“There is no room for excuses. Kogi has both the talent and the infrastructure including a standard handball court in Lokoja to become a force in Nigerian handball,” he added.
In his acceptance remarks, Coach Omada Ene-Ojo expressed gratitude to the Chairman and the association for the confidence placed in him. He pledged to justify the trust by working diligently to develop the sport and create more opportunities for young players in the state.
“I’m honored by this appointment and deeply grateful to the association for this recognition. I promise to give my very best in promoting the growth of handball in Kogi State,” he said.
Coach Omada’s appointment is expected to mark a new era of technical and grassroots development for handball in Kogi State.
